Jacksonville and St. Augustine Wedding Guide: Venues, Costs, Seasons, Beach Permits, and Local Planning Tips
Jacksonville is practical. St. Augustine is atmospheric.
That is the real choice.
Jacksonville gives couples hotels, airport access, riverfront venues, beaches, private clubs, Ponte Vedra resorts, Amelia Island access, and enough space for a larger wedding to breathe. St. Augustine gives cobblestones, Spanish colonial architecture, courtyards, old city streets, historic inns, bayfront views, and one of the most distinctive wedding backdrops in Florida.
Jacksonville is better for guest logistics and larger weddings. St. Augustine is better for couples who want character, history, and a smaller, more walkable destination weekend.

Choose the Base Before the Venue
A downtown Jacksonville wedding works best for riverfront venues, hotels, restaurants, museums, and guests flying in.
A Jacksonville Beach or Atlantic Beach wedding gives couples a more casual coastal weekend with easier access than some resort towns.
A Ponte Vedra wedding is the polished resort and club version. It works well for larger budgets, older relatives, and classic coastal receptions.
An Amelia Island wedding becomes a full resort or island weekend, and should be treated separately from Jacksonville.
A St. Augustine wedding is strongest when guests can stay in or near the historic district. The more walkable the weekend, the better it feels.
If you want old Florida romance, choose St. Augustine. If you want convenience and scale, choose Jacksonville or Ponte Vedra.
Best Time of Year for a Jacksonville or St. Augustine Wedding
March, April, May, October, and November are the strongest months. The weather is more comfortable, outdoor ceremonies are easier, and historic St. Augustine feels better before deep summer heat.
June through September can work, but heat, humidity, thunderstorms, and hurricane season should be part of the plan.
December through February can be excellent for St. Augustine courtyards, indoor outdoor venues, private clubs, and resort weddings. Winter is one of Northeast Florida’s advantages.
My pick: April or November. Both give couples Florida atmosphere without the most punishing weather.
How Much Does a Jacksonville or St. Augustine Wedding Cost?
| Wedding Style | Typical Planning Range |
|---|---|
| Courthouse, beach elopement, or private dining wedding | $5,000 to $25,000 |
| Small restaurant, inn, or private room wedding | $20,000 to $60,000 |
| Small Jacksonville or St. Augustine wedding with 40 to 80 guests | $30,000 to $85,000 |
| Full service wedding with 100 to 150 guests | $70,000 to $180,000 plus |
| Luxury resort, Ponte Vedra, Amelia Island, historic, or tented weekend | $200,000 to $350,000 plus |
The biggest cost drivers are venue rental, catering, bar, rentals, florals, transportation, hotel blocks, beach permits, planner support, lighting, and weather backup.
The line couples underestimate most often is historic district movement in St. Augustine. Narrow streets, tourists, parking, and cobblestones need a plan.
Marriage License and Beach Permit Notes
Duval County lists the Florida marriage license fee at $86, with a $25 reduction for Florida residents who provide proof of a qualifying premarital preparation course.
St. Johns County states that a Florida marriage license is valid only in Florida for 60 days, that Florida residents have a three day waiting period unless they complete an approved premarital course, and that there is no waiting period for non Florida residents.
For St. Augustine beach weddings, the City of St. Augustine Beach lists special event permit fees at $100, with significant events required to submit an additional $300 bond.
Best Venue Styles
Jacksonville Riverfront and Downtown Venues
Best for guest logistics, hotel blocks, larger receptions, and couples who want Florida without a beach centered weekend
Ponte Vedra Resorts and Private Clubs
Best for polished coastal weddings, golf weekends, older relatives, and all in one guest experiences
Jacksonville Beach and Atlantic Beach Weddings
Best for relaxed coastal energy, smaller guest lists, and couples who want beach access without too much formality
St. Augustine Historic Inns, Courtyards, and Bayfront Venues
Best for intimate to mid sized weddings, architecture, walkability, restaurants, and couples who want the setting to do real visual work
Amelia Island Weddings
Best for resort weekends, beach portraits, and guests who are comfortable staying on island rather than commuting

Where Guests Should Stay
For Jacksonville weddings, stay downtown, near the beaches, or near the venue. For Ponte Vedra, keep guests at or near the resort. For St. Augustine, keep guests in or near the historic district whenever possible. For Amelia Island, guests should stay on island.
The Logistics Couples Usually Miss
- St. Augustine parking is limited.
- Historic streets affect shuttles, heels, and timing.
- Summer storms are real.
- Beach permits vary by location.
- Jacksonville is geographically large.
- Ponte Vedra and Amelia Island are not casual add ons to downtown Jacksonville.
Final Planning Advice
Choose practical Florida or historic Florida.
Jacksonville is easier. St. Augustine is more memorable. Ponte Vedra is more polished. Amelia Island is more contained. Each can be the right choice, but the weekend should belong to one of them.
